KABUL (Pajhwok): The government on Wednesday declared an emergency situation in the country due to heavy snowfall.
Bilal Karimi, the government’s spokesman, confirmed to Pajhwok Afghan News declaration of the emergency situation.
He said: “The Ministries of Disaster Management and Public Works are preparing to clear roads in all parts of the country.”
Contracts are being signed with various companies on clearing roads in areas where there are problems and citizens face difficulties.”
He added under the instructions given to the agencies concerned, food, clothing and medicine had been delivered to calamity-prone areas. Essential items have been distributed in some places.
The authorities were trying to intensify the distribution of these items so that the ongoing snowfall did not cause problems to the people, Karimi continued.
